What Is Stratosphere Discovery Day?

June 8th is "Stratosphere Discovery Day." It marks the day in 1902 when French meteorologist Léon Teisserenc de Bort confirmed through observation that the atmosphere contains layers with different temperature structures. This discovery scientifically demonstrated that Earth's atmosphere isn't uniform, but has a layered structure.

The Background of the Discovery

From the late 19th into the early 20th century, meteorologists were working to observe the upper atmosphere at higher altitudes. Teisserenc de Bort conducted repeated balloon observations and discovered that above a certain altitude, temperatures stopped decreasing with height. This observation became the decisive evidence for the existence of the stratosphere.

What Is the Stratosphere?

The stratosphere is the layer of the atmosphere located above the troposphere. It extends roughly from 10 to 50km above the Earth's surface, and is characterized by temperatures that increase with altitude—the opposite of the troposphere below it.

  • Location: Above the troposphere
  • Altitude: Approximately 10–50km
  • Temperature structure: Temperature rises with altitude

Its Relationship with the Ozone Layer

The stratosphere contains the ozone layer, which protects Earth from ultraviolet radiation. Ozone absorbs UV rays and generates heat in the process, which creates the stratosphere's distinctive temperature structure.

The Impact of the Discovery

The discovery of the stratosphere led to major advances in atmospheric science. It provided essential foundational knowledge that improved weather forecasting accuracy and contributed to research in aviation and aerospace.

  • Establishing the concept of the atmosphere as a layered structure
  • Advances in meteorology and climatology
  • Applications in aircraft and rocket development

The Stratosphere in Modern Science

Today, the stratosphere remains an important subject of research in climate change and ozone layer studies. Satellites and high-altitude observation instruments continuously monitor its conditions.
